Unilever exits Rahu
Rahu was founded in early 2006 as a spin-out from Anglo-Dutch consumer goods maker Unilever's Ventures unit that incubates ideas and takes minority equity stakes in UK entrepreneurs and managed by co-founders Paul Smith and Dermott Hill.

Jan 5, 2012Cargill looks for growth in AgriNurture
Agro-commercial business AgriNurture has raised $30m in funding from agribusiness conglomerate Cargill, which has taken a 28% stake.

Dec 24, 2011Gehry Technologies builds for the future
The building technology company co-founded by Frank Gehry has raised $10m in series B financing with involvement from 3D design software firms.
